New Ben Cousins Interview

Posted On: Thursday 14 August 2008

Gamespot recently got a chance to sit down with the infamous Ben Cousins, the lead producer for Battlefield Heroes. In the interview, Cousins revealed, among other themes, that nearly 10,000 players have joined the beta and clocked in over 16,000 hours of game play time. "GS: This microtransactions model hasn't taken root yet in the West. What do you look at in terms of successful predecessors for the microtransactions model in the US? Yohoho Puzzle Pirates? Acclaim's games?

BC: MapleStory is doing really well, and Puzzle Pirates is also doing well. I've been going to a microtransactions roundtable at each Game Developers Conference over the last few years, and there used to be maybe a few guys operating small businesses, small-scale role-playing games and that kind of thing. When I went this year, it was clear there were a large number of [successful developers].

I think it's interesting Heroes is the first microtransactions-based game from a major publisher. So we appear to be breaking the ice and doing something cutting-edge, but there's a good precedent in the West for reasonable success for a smaller-scale business. There's an audience there and a demand for this sort of game, and we think we can bust it open with Heroes with a higher profile and the higher-quality game we're offering."
